So I am having problems with our Taurus G2 PT111. The other day at the range it stopped firing. Pull the trigger and nothing, does not even act like its engaging the striker to hit the firing pin. Went to take it apart to clean and inspect and I cannot get the slide off because the last part of removing the slide is to pull the trigger as you slide the slide forward and off. Wound up taking it to a shop and they see the same thing but they were able to remove the striker and backplate to get the slide off. Now it sits in my safe in 2 pieces awaiting further inspection.
Anybody have an idea? Is it possible that the trigger bar got bent?
